This role is available across our London, Bristol and Manchester locations. The Government Digital Service (GDS) is the digital centre of government. We are responsible for setting, leading and delivering the vision for a modern digital government. Our priorities are to drive a modern digital government by:

  • joining up public sector services
  • harnessing the power of AI for the public good
  • strengthening and extending our digital and data public infrastructure
  • elevating leadership and investing in talent
  • funding for outcomes and procuring for growth and innovation
  • committing to transparency and driving accountability

We are home to the Incubator for Artificial Intelligence (I.AI), the world-leading GOV.UK and at the forefront of coordinating the UK’s geospatial strategy and activity. We lead the Government Digital and Data function and champion the work of digital teams across government. We’re part of the Department for Science, Innovation and Technology (DSIT) and employ more than 1,000 people all over the UK, with hubs in Manchester, London and Bristol. As a Senior Test Engineer, you will join the Quality Engineering team within the GOV.UK One Login program. This role involves leading test engineering efforts for product and cross-product delivery, covering both functional and non-functional testing. A key part of this role is championing quality engineering initiatives to ensure the seamless integration and delivery of reliable and resilient products. You will also have the opportunity to drive innovation in testing methodologies, mentor team members, and embed quality engineering practices throughout our software development lifecycle.

As a Senior Test Engineer, you’ll:

  • drive continuous improvement by leading and guiding teams in quality engineering, and optimising quality practices and processes
  • act as a subject matter expert in test engineering, continuously learning new functional and non-functional testing (performance, accessibility, resilience etc.) technologies, and supporting teams with their adoption
  • lead and guide quality engineers in defining the test approach, test planning, and implementing automated test suites to ensure both functional and non-functional acceptance criteria are met
  • conduct Operational Acceptance Testing (OAT) to ensure systems meet all operational requirements and are production-ready
  • analyse technical, functional, and business requirements, gathering evidence to identify problems and opportunities, and ensure recommendations align with strategic business objectives
  • influence the architecture and design of new features early in the development cycle to drive quality, testability, and specification adherence

We’re interested in people who:

  • have proven ability to lead and manage all phases of testing (functional and non-functional) across multiple teams, from initial business understanding through to production delivery. This includes expertise in technical leadership, quality improvement, developing test strategies, automation, reporting, and testing in CI/CD environments
  • have experience in leading non-functional testing, specifically Performance, Accessibility, Resilience testing and Compatibility testing. Proficient in applying a diverse range of test types, tools, and industry standards
  • are an adaptable team member within a Continuous Integration/Continuous Delivery (CI/CD) environment, demonstrating competency in the deployment of relevant tools and methodologies. Initiates proactive measures to implement and champion 'shift left and shift right' quality assurance principles
  • can cultivate a quality-centric, 'whole team' approach, and enhance the testing capabilities within delivery teams
  • have comprehensive understanding of production testing, observability, and real‑usage monitoring. Able to implement risk‑based test strategies that guarantee system reliability and provide actionable insights into user behaviour

Please note that this role requires SC clearance, which would normally need 5 years’ UK residency in the past 5 years. This is not an absolute requirement, but supplementary checks may be needed where individuals have not lived in the UK for that period. This may mean your security clearance (and therefore your appointment) will take longer or, in some cases, not be possible. Please note DSIT cannot offer Visa sponsorship to candidates through this campaign. DSIT holds a Visa sponsorship licence but this can only be used for certain roles and this campaign does not qualify.
